It was the worst day since Lee Kang-in joined Atlético. The 25-year-old showed flashes early in the match, including hitting the post, but was substituted off early amid his team's lifeless and decisive defeat.

On the 5th at 11:15 p.m. (Korean time), Lee Kang-in's club Atlético suffered a 0-3 away loss to Athletic Bilbao in Round 4 of the 2026–2027 Spanish La Liga, held at Estadio de San Mamés in Bilbao, Spain.

As a result, Atlético recorded its first defeat after four opening matches (2 wins, 1 draw, 1 loss), ending its unbeaten run. Meanwhile, Bilbao bounced back from two consecutive losses to win two straight games, boosting their momentum.

Football statistics specialist 'FootMob' awarded Lee Kang-in a rating of 6.7 for his 58 minutes on the pitch — a clear drop compared to his previous three matches. In the opening match against Málaga, he played 33 minutes and scored, earning a 7.9 rating. Even in the Villarreal match where he recorded no attacking contributions, he received a solid 7.3 rating.

In his previous match against Sevilla, where he provided his first assist while playing 72 minutes, he earned a 7.9 rating. However, on this day, amid his team's overall poor performance, he recorded the lowest rating since joining Atlético.

According to media reports, Lee Kang-in touched the ball 41 times and was involved in attacking buildup. He took two shots, including one that struck the post, delivered one key pass, completed 78% of his passes (18/23), made four successful passes in the attacking zone, and completed one long pass.

Additionally, Lee Kang-in successfully completed all three of his dribble attempts (100%), made three touches inside the opponent's box, won four ground duels (50%), and committed one foul — yet he was unable to turn the tide.

Starting alongside Ademola Lookman up front, Lee Kang-in primarily operated between the right flank and the half-space area, delivering sharp performances in the early stages of the first half.

There were also missed opportunities. Just three minutes after kickoff, Lee Kang-in received a pass from Pablo Barrios on the right side of the goal and struck a right-footed ground shot that hit the left post. In the 23rd minute, he drew defenders away before creating a perfect shooting chance for Alex Baena. By the 40th minute, he had beaten defenders with a solo dribble from the right flank and connected with a left-footed shot.

However, immediately after the second half began, Atlético's defense collapsed, conceding consecutive goals to Nico Williams and Robert Navarro. With the score quickly slipping to 0-2, manager Diego Simeone made the decision in the 14th minute of the second half to bring on four players simultaneously, including Lee Kang-in. Lee was substituted off after 58 minutes, replaced by Julián Álvarez.

Even after Lee's departure, Atlético failed to threaten Bilbao's goal. Julián Álvarez's left-footed turning shot and Marcos Llorente's mid-range strike both targeted the net but fell short of beating goalkeeper Unai Simón. Instead, they conceded a third goal in the 45th minute of the second half, suffering a heavy defeat.
